Acetyl Chloride Sales Market Outlook
The global acetyl chloride market is projected to reach a valuation of approximately USD 1.5 billion by 2033, growing at a compound annual growth rate (CAGR) of around 4.5% during the forecast period from 2025 to 2033. The growth of the market can be attributed to the increasing demand for acetyl chloride in various industries such as pharmaceuticals, agrochemicals, and chemical synthesis. The rising need for advanced chemical intermediates, particularly in drug manufacturing and agricultural applications, is also propelling the market forward. Additionally, the growing trend of developing innovative chemicals for various applications is expected to further boost market growth. Increasing industrial activities and the expansion of end-use industries in emerging economies are also significant factors contributing to the rising demand for acetyl chloride.

Chemical Synthesis:
Acetyl chloride is widely employed in chemical synthesis across various industries, serving as a building block in the production of numerous organic compounds. Its versatility allows for the acetylation of alcohols, amines, and other nucleophiles, making it a highly sought-after reagent in synthetic organic chemistry. The growth of the chemical synthesis application is largely influenced by the rising demand for specialized chemicals in sectors such as textiles, plastics, and specialty chemicals. As manufacturers seek to enhance their product portfolios and innovate new chemical solutions, the utilization of acetyl chloride in chemical synthesis is expected to witness significant growth.

By Region
The acetyl chloride market is experiencing varied growth trajectories across different regions, influenced by local industrial demands and regulatory environments. In North America, the market is projected to reach USD 500 million by 2033, accounting for a substantial share due to the presence of advanced pharmaceutical and chemical industries. The region is characterized by high standards for product quality and safety, encouraging manufacturers to invest in high-grade acetyl chloride. The CAGR in North America is estimated at around 4% during the forecast period, driven by continuous innovations in drug development and chemical manufacturing processes.
In Europe, the acetyl chloride market is expected to maintain a robust growth rate, fueled by the increasing focus on sustainable chemicals and green chemistry initiatives. With a projected market size of USD 400 million by 2033, Europe is witnessing a shift towards more environmentally friendly alternatives in chemical production, which positively impacts the demand for acetyl chloride as an essential reagent. The Asia Pacific region is anticipated to showcase the highest growth potential, with a CAGR of approximately 5% during the forecast period. The rapid industrialization and expansion of the pharmaceutical and agricultural sectors in countries like China and India are significant driving forces behind this growth, positioning Asia Pacific as a key player in the acetyl chloride market.

Threats
Despite the promising growth prospects, the acetyl chloride market faces several threats that could hinder its expansion. One significant concern is the volatility in raw material prices, which can impact production costs and subsequently affect profit margins. Fluctuations in the prices of chlorine and acetic acid, essential raw materials for acetyl chloride production, can lead to unpredictability in manufacturing expenses. Additionally, any regulatory changes regarding the handling and production of hazardous chemicals may impose stricter compliance requirements and increase operational costs for manufacturers. Such regulatory barriers could deter new entrants into the market and affect the competitive landscape.
